Black Sunday made Cypress Hill's connection to rock & roll more explicit, with its heavy metal-like artwork and noisier, more dissonant samples (including, naturally, stoner icons Black Sabbath). It's a slightly darker affair than its groundbreaking predecessor, with the threats of violence more urgent and the pot obsession played to the hilt (after all, it was a crucial part of their widespread appeal). Apart from those subtle distinctions, the sound of Black Sunday is pretty much the same as Cypress Hill, refining the group's innovations into an accessible bid for crossover success. Throughout their long career, Cypress Hill have been rightfully considered as pioneers in the rap and hip-hop scene, accorded the same reverence reserved for the likes of NWA, Public Enemy and Run DMC.

Their constant advocacy of marijuana use and legalisation was what first attracted notoriety, fortunately over time they have left a much better heritage musically. Their clever deployment of slow rolling bass and drum lines- a technique also used by Dr. Dre and Massive Attack- has become common place in rap. They were amongst the first to fuse rap with heavy metal and form “nu-metal”; and in more recent times they have integrated reggae and latino influences into their work. For all this they must be praised.
